Frequently Asked Questions
Will my fence posts heave or shift during winter?
Yes, without proper footings. The Rancho Calaveras Estates area has a 12-inch frost line. IRC Section R403.1.4 requires concrete footings to extend below this depth to prevent frost heave from lifting posts. Posts set in shallow concrete will fail within two seasons.
What is required before digging post holes?
You must call USA North 811 for a utility locate. Hitting a gas or fiber line in Rancho Calaveras Estates creates major liability and repair costs. We manage the 811 ticket and pull any required permits from the Calaveras County permit office as part of the contract.
What are my legal responsibilities to my neighbor when building a fence?
California Civil Code 841 governs partition fences. As of 2026, you must provide written notice to all adjoining property owners at least 30 days before replacing a shared boundary fence in Rancho Calaveras. This is a strict legal prerequisite, regardless of the 0-foot setback.
Can I automate my gate for pool security?
Yes. Integrating a smart gate with an ASTM F2286-compliant, self-closing/latching mechanism meets the Calaveras County Building Code. The moderate smart-gate trend reflects demand for IoT latches that provide access logs, enhancing liability protection for California homeowners.
What fencing materials last longest here?
Material compatibility is key. With moderate soil corrosivity and termite risk, pressure-treated wood or composite posts are standard. Use hot-dip galvanized or stainless steel fasteners to prevent rust streaks from forming on the finish.
How tall can I build my fence, and are there location restrictions?
Rancho Calaveras zoning is 3 feet for front yards and 6 feet for rear/side yards. The 0-foot setback allows building directly on your property line. For corner lots, you must maintain a clear 'sight triangle' for traffic visibility, a critical rule for properties near CA-26.
Is my fence designed for high winds?
It must be. The 105 MPH V-ult wind speed rating dictates structural design. We calculate post spacing, concrete footing mass, and bracket strength per ASCE 7-22 standards to survive peak storm season gusts common in this region.
